China’s economy has bounced back after last year’s deep coronavirus slump,  propelled by stronger demand at home and abroad and continued government support for smaller firms.
Key points:

  • Analysts say China’s growth will return to modest levels through the rest of the year
  • Manufacturing and consumer activity has returned to pre-coronavirus levels
  • Exports have led the country’s economic recovery

But the brisk expansion, heavily skewed by the plunge in activity a year earlier, is expected to moderate…
